Title: problem with rec. hole pattern wiz. also
Post by: fourxfour2 on June 04, 2007, 05:50:01 PM
 My problem.. I'm trying to put holes .500 apart so I set the wiz up for 15 holes wide and 92 long 1" deep And all I get in gcode is some .500 moves in Y but the X is moving in .01 to .20  to all differnt moves....  Is me or the wiz.
Attached is the Gcode from the Wiz
Title: Re: problem with rec. hole pattern wiz. also
Post by: Ron Ginger on June 04, 2007, 08:06:30 PM
The code looks correct, note that the G81 is a modal command, and every X and Y following it drills another hole.

But it looks like you only made the X distance .5, so you got 92 holes in the first .5 inch. The wizard wants to know the total length and width of the hole pattern, not the distance between holes
